Duplicate Resolution Service
The service to find and merge duplicate parties and the child entities.
Life Cycle Status: Active
QName: {http://xmlns.oracle.com/apps/cdm/dataStewardship/resolutionService/}DuplicateResolutionService
Service WSDL URL: https://servername/crmService/DuplicateResolutionService?WSDL
Logical Business Objects
-
CRM : Trading Community Hub : Trading Community Duplicate Resolution Request
Relationships
The following table describes how this service data object is related to other service data objects or business object services.
Relationship Type | Object or Service |
---|---|
Handles |
|
Handles |
|
Handles |
|
Handles |
Operations
getResolutionRequest
A web service method which queries a single record of resolution request based on the primary key identifier.
Life Cycle Status: Active
Request Payload
Element Name | Type | Description |
---|---|---|
requestId |
long |
Input parameter of the getResolutionRequest web service method. It is the primary key identifier of the request you want to query for. |
Response Payload
Element Name | Type | Description |
---|---|---|
result |
{http://xmlns.oracle.com/apps/cdm/dataStewardship/resolutionService/}ResolutionRequestResult |
The return value of getResolutionRequest web service method. It includes the key set of attributes for the queried request identifier. |
findResolutionRequest
A web service method that queries a single record or set of records of resolution request objects that match the supplied criteria
Life Cycle Status: Active
Request Payload
Element Name | Type | Description |
---|---|---|
findCriteria |
{http://xmlns.oracle.com/adf/svc/types/}FindCriteria |
A required input parameter of the findResolutionRequest web service method. The criteria used to limit the query result, such as the filter (where clause). |
findControl |
{http://xmlns.oracle.com/adf/svc/types/}FindControl |
Find Control. Not currently used. |
Response Payload
Element Name | Type | Description |
---|---|---|
result |
The result of the findResolutionRequest operation that includes the successfully resolved and merged parties and a list of warning or information messages. |
getDfltObjAttrHints
An operation to retrieve user interface hints, such as the service data object label and object attribute labels, for the specified service data object and locale. As a prerequisite, invoke the getEntityList operation defined on this service to get the list of possible values for the viewName request payload element.
Life Cycle Status: Active
Request Payload
Element Name | Type | Description |
---|---|---|
viewName |
string |
The service view usage name, an internal name for the service data object. Specify the value of the <name> element from the getEntityList operation response payload. |
localeName |
string |
The locale to use when evaluating locale-based user interface hints. The localeName is in ISO 639-1 format. |
Response Payload
Element Name | Type | Description |
---|---|---|
result |
{http://xmlns.oracle.com/adf/svc/types/}ObjAttrHints |
The label and user interface hints for the specified service data object and its attributes in a name-value pair format |
getServiceLastUpdateTime
An operation that returns the date and time when the schema files referenced in the service definition last changed.
Life Cycle Status: Active
Request Payload
Response Payload
Element Name | Type | Description |
---|---|---|
result |
{http://xmlns.oracle.com/adf/svc/types/}dateTime-Timestamp |
The date and time when the service definition last changed in ISO 8601 format. |
getEntityList
An operation to get the list of service data objects defined on this service.
Life Cycle Status: Active
Request Payload
Response Payload
Element Name | Type | Description |
---|---|---|
result |
{http://xmlns.oracle.com/adf/svc/types/}ServiceViewInfo |
An operation to get the list of service data objects defined on this service. |
Security
The following tables list the privileges required to perform the service operations, and the duty roles that each privilege is granted to.
Service Operations to Privileges Mapping
Operation Name | Privilege Code | Privilege Name | Privilege Description |
---|---|---|---|
getResolutionRequest |
ZCH_VIEW_TRADING_COMMUNITY_DUPLICATE_RESOLUTION_REQUEST_PRIV |
View Trading Community Duplicate Resolution Request |
Allows viewing of the duplicate resolution request details. |
findResolutionRequest |
ZCH_VIEW_TRADING_COMMUNITY_DUPLICATE_RESOLUTION_REQUEST_PRIV |
View Trading Community Duplicate Resolution Request |
Allows viewing of the duplicate resolution request details. |
Privileges to Duty Roles Mapping
Privilege Code | Granted to Duty Role Code | Granted to Duty Role Name | Granted To Duty Role Description |
---|---|---|---|
ZCH_VIEW_TRADING_COMMUNITY_DUPLICATE_RESOLUTION_REQUEST_PRIV |
ORA_DUP_RES_MANAGE_DUTY |
Trading Community Duplicate Resolution Request Management |
Grants privileges to manage duplicate resolution requests |
ZCH_VIEW_TRADING_COMMUNITY_DUPLICATE_RESOLUTION_REQUEST_PRIV |
ORA_DUP_RES_INQUIRY_DUTY |
Trading Community Duplicate Resolution Request Inquiry |
Grants privileges to view duplicate resolution requests |
ZCH_VIEW_TRADING_COMMUNITY_DUPLICATE_RESOLUTION_REQUEST_PRIV |
ORA_ZCH_DATA_STEWARD_MANAGER_JOB |
Data Steward Manager |
Manages customer data stewards and has additional privileges including assigning requests. |
Duty Roles to Duty or Job Roles Mapping
Duty Role Code | Granted to Duty or Job Role Code | Granted to Duty or Job Role Name | Granted To Duty or Job Role Description |
---|---|---|---|
ORA_ZCH_DATA_STEWARD_MANAGER_JOB |
ORA_ZCA_ACCESS_GROUPS_ENABLEMENT_DUTY |
Access Groups Enablement |
Enables the Access Groups functionality. |
ORA_ZCH_DATA_STEWARD_MANAGER_JOB |
ORA_ZCH_VIEW_PARTY_CENTER_DUTY |
Party Center Inquiry |
Grants privileges to view party center nodes. |
ORA_ZCH_DATA_STEWARD_MANAGER_JOB |
ORA_ZCH_MANAGE_PARTY_CENTER_DUTY |
Party Center Management |
Grants privileges to manage party center nodes. |
ORA_ZCH_DATA_STEWARD_MANAGER_JOB |
ORA_ZCQ_TRADING_COMMUNITY_DQ_MGMT_DUTY |
Trading Community Data Quality Management |
Performs real-time and batch data quality functions such as matching and cleansing. |
ORA_ZCH_DATA_STEWARD_MANAGER_JOB |
ORA_DUP_IDEN_MANAGE_DUTY |
Trading Community Duplicate Identification Batch Management |
Grants privileges to manage duplicate identification batches |
ORA_DUP_RES_MANAGE_DUTY |
ORA_DUP_RES_INQUIRY_DUTY |
Trading Community Duplicate Resolution Request Inquiry |
Grants privileges to view duplicate resolution requests |
ORA_ZCH_DATA_STEWARD_MANAGER_JOB |
ORA_DUP_RES_MANAGE_DUTY |
Trading Community Duplicate Resolution Request Management |
Grants privileges to manage duplicate resolution requests |
ORA_ZCH_DATA_STEWARD_MANAGER_JOB |
ORA_MANAGE_TRADING_COMMUNITY_IMPORT_BATCH_DUTY |
Trading Community Import Batch Management |
Manages trading community data import batches. |
ORA_ZCH_DATA_STEWARD_MANAGER_JOB |
ORA_MANAGE_TRADING_COMMUNITY_IMPORT_PROCESS_DUTY |
Trading Community Import Process Management |
Manages trading community data import batch processes. |